在前面两节,读写的文件都是针对文本文件。这一节,重点讲述二进制文件的读写。什么是二进制文件呢?
entry与output,顾名思义,就是打包的入口与输出,其实之前我们已经接触了这两个参数,下面详细介绍一下这两个参数的配置。
代码清单3-6 Int CalculateStringDistance(string strA, int pABegin, int pAEnd, string strB, int pBBegin
本文链接:https://blog.csdn.net/shiliang97/article/details/101221630 3-6 银行业务队列简单模拟 (20 分) 设某银行有A、B两个业务窗口
在 numpy 中合并数组比较常用的方法有 concatenate、vstack 和 hstack。在介绍这三个方法之前,首先创建几个不同维度的数组:
本文讲ibd2sql的使用,建议使用源码(没得依赖包, 除了要求python3)介绍ibd2sql是解析mysql 8.0的ibd文件, 并生成DDL和DML, 还支持解析出被删除的数据(当然也可以解析 是否支持varchar(n) 是 char(n) n 是 int 4 是 date 3 是 date/time (n)3- /ibd2sql /data/mysql_3314/mysqldata/db1/t20230427_test.ibd --ddl图片解析出DML其实应该叫数据, 只是显示为insert格式,方便插入. /ibd2sql /data/mysql_3314/mysqldata/db1/t20230427_test.ibd --sql图片解析delete解析被标记为删除的, 就是执行delete之后的数据. /ibd2sql /data/mysql_3314/mysqldata/db1/t20230427_test.ibd --delete图片看起来是不是很dio >_<算是对之前解析ibd文件的总结吧 -
添加后稍安勿躁 一一通过 不适合学生群体 如有相关编程经验可酌情考虑 除了按大厂,我还按 Java 技术栈的维度,给你梳理了 Java 的 15 个核心技术点:Java I/O、JVM、Kafka、MySQL
SQLMap内置了很多绕过插件,支持的数据库是MySQL、Oracle、PostgreSQL、Microsoft SQL Server、Microsoft Access、IBM DB2、SQLite、Firebird 信息中有三处需要选择的地方:第一处的意思为检测到数据库可能是MySQL,是否跳过并检测其他数据库;第二处的意思是在“level1、risk1”的情况下,是否使用MySQL对应的所有Payload进行检测 图3-5 运行如下命令,判断是否存在注入: python sqlmap.py –r 1.txt 运行后的结果如图3-6所示,参数“-r ”一般在存在Cookie注入时使用。 图3-6 3.查询当前用户下的所有数据库 该命令是确定网站存在注入后,用于查询当前用户下的所有数据库,命令如下: python sqlmap.py -u http://10.211.55.6/Less id=1" --passwords 从图3-12中可以看出,密码采用MySQL 5加密方式,可以在解密网站中自行解密。
2025年9月,腾讯云官网把“低成本+快见效”写进了产品说明书:用腾讯云BI,零代码拖拽就能让Excel、MySQL、Oracle、API等存量数据秒变可视化大屏;按量计费最低0.29元/小时,首月套餐 1天 网关首月免费,MySQL 1元/月 2 制作报表 腾讯云BI 2天 1元套餐(30天) 3 29元、企业版99元/月 四、新老方案成本&速度对比 方案 开发周期 人力投入 首年费用 上线风险 传统BI自建 3- ”组合套餐,1核2G+1元MySQL,10分钟装好。 轻量服务器1核2G 3年168元,送同地域MySQL1元使用权。 开通后完成“新手指战”,再返50元通用代金券。
1.2 传统开发模式的三大障碍 成本高昂:定制开发需组建IT团队,人力成本占项目总预算60%以上 周期漫长:从需求调研到上线平均需3-6个月,错失市场机遇 维护困难:服务器采购、代码更新等运维成本占系统总成本 低代码平台成最优解 2.1 主流方案功能与成本对比 维度 传统开发 低代码平台(如Zoho Creator) 腾讯云CloudBase 开发周期 3- 步搭建企业级系统 3.1 0成本启动方案 首月免费体验:新用户赠送100万次云函数调用+50GB存储 AI辅助搭建:输入“生成带支付功能的商城系统”,自动生成前后端代码 数据迁移工具:支持Excel、MySQL
安装完mysql后, 要及得配置一下 /etc/mysql/my.cnf 配置字符编码为utf8 [client] default-character-set = utf8 [mysqld] default-storage-engine
myview说白了就是把select查出来的东西变成了临时表结构,放在表之中,这个表就是视图。好处就是获取一些高频访问的数据时,不用在做多表查询了,直接以视图的方式查看即可。
MySQL安装 配置内置环境 输入 ps axj | grep mysql 查看系统当中是否有已经安装好的MySQL ---- 输入 ps ajx | grep mariadb 查看系统是否有 mariadb 存在(mariadb为MySQL的开源分支) ---- 关闭MySQL 在root用户下进行 若输入 ps axj | grep mysql,存在MySQL 输入 systemctl stop 正常来说,应该为上一个mysql残留的数据,但是由于这里没有使用过mysql,所以就什么都没有 (mysql卸载时,默认没有把数据删掉) 配置MySQL yum源 点击查看: mysql官方yum 若存在 /bin/mysql,则说明存在mysql的客户端 ---- MySQL的启动 输入 systemctl start mysqld 指令 启动mysql 然后 输入 ps ajx | grep restart mysqld 指令 ,即可重启mysql 再次输入 mysql -uroot -p 指令 登录 MySQL MySQL的配置文件 MySQL统一使用 utf-8的方式来进行编码 输入
MySQL 也不例外。 日志分类 错误日志 二进制日志 查询日志 慢查询日志 错误日志 错误日志是 MySQL 中最重要的日志之一,它记录了当 mysqld 启动和停止时,以及服务器在运行 过程中发生任何严重错误时的相关信息 该日志是默认开启的 , 默认存放目录为 mysql 的数据目录, 默认的日志文件名为 hostname.err(hostname是主机名)。 此日志对于灾难时的数据恢复起着极其重要的作用,MySQL的主 从复制, 就是通过该binlog实现的。 二进制日志,MySQl8.0默认已经开启,低版本的MySQL的需 要通过配置文件开启,并配置MySQL日志的格式。
CPU:4核,内存:8GB,关系数据管理系统:mySQL 5.7(做好读写分离)。 同时开通相关云存储服务。 2、第二阶段 此阶段进入宣传推广阶段,时间大约是3-6个月,若以在线用户3000-5000人左右为参考,那么推荐的配置如下(在此特别说明一下:一对一直播系统的ECS可以少买1台,因为不需要socket) CPU:8核,内存:16GB,关系数据管理系统:mySQL 5.7以上(做好读写分离)。 同时开通相关云存储服务。 RDS:1台 CPU:8核,内存:16GB,关系数据管理系统:mySQL 5.7(做好读写分离) 同时开通相关的云存储服务。
使用C/C++语言链接MySQL 一、mysql connect 要使用C语言连接 mysql,需要使用 mysql 官网提供的库,大家可以去官网下载。 初始化 mysql_init() 想要使用库,必须先进行初始化,其函数为 mysql_init(),其在官方文档中的定义如下: MYSQL *mysql_init(MYSQL *mysql); (mysql 网络部分是基于 TCP/IP 的),其在官方文档的定义如下: MYSQL *mysql_real_connect(MYSQL *mysql, const char *host, 原型如下: MYSQL_RES *mysql_store_result(MYSQL *mysql); 该函数会调用 MYSQL 变量中的 st_mysql_methods 中的 read_rows (MYSQL_RES *res); 获取列属性 mysql_fetch_fields MYSQL_FIELD *mysql_fetch_fields(MYSQL_RES *res); mysql_fetch_fields
1.2 传统开发模式的三大障碍 成本高昂:定制开发需组建IT团队,人力成本占项目总预算60%以上 周期漫长:从需求调研到上线平均需3-6个月,错失市场机遇 维护困难:服务器采购、代码更新等运维成本占系统总成本 低代码平台成最优解 2.1 主流方案功能与成本对比 维度 传统开发 低代码平台(如Zoho Creator) 腾讯云CloudBase 开发周期 3- 步搭建企业级系统 3.1 0成本启动方案 首月免费体验:新用户赠送100万次云函数调用+50GB存储 AI辅助搭建:输入“生成带支付功能的商城系统”,自动生成前后端代码 数据迁移工具:支持Excel、MySQL
MySql简介 MySql作为一种开源的轻量级数据库(关系型数据库),在开源数据库中比较流行,由于小巧安装方便快捷,经常会用于互联网公司, 维护也比较方便。 创建一个班级表 mysql> create database school; #创建数据库school mysql> use school; #选择数据库school mysql> create 代码示例: mysql> create database school; #创建数据库school mysql> use school; #选择数据库school mysql> create 中文分词支持 配置文件my.ini(Windows 10默认路径: C:\ProgramData\MySQL\MySQL Server 8.0) 中增加如下配置项,同时重启MySQL80 服务: [mysqld MySQL中规定自增列必须为主键。
`database_name` = '数据库名’; select * from mysql.`innodb_index_stats` a where a. `database_name` = '数据库名' and a.table_name like '%表名%’; select * from mysql. 是因为mysql本身就有一层sql优化,他会根据sql来识别出来该用哪个索引,我们可以理解为3和4在mysql眼中是等价的。 全文索引的版本、存储引擎、数据类型的支持情况: MySQL 5.6 以前的版本,只有 MyISAM 存储 引擎支持全文索引; MySQL 5.6 及以后的版本,MyISAM 和 InnoDB 存储引擎均支持全文索引 MySQL 中的全文索引,有两个变量,最小搜索长度和最大搜索长度,对于长度小于最小搜索长度 和大于最大搜索长度的词语,都不会被索引。
所属专栏:MySQL 1. 索引概述 MySQL中的索引是帮助MySQL高效获取数据的数据结构,可以极大地提高数据库的查询效率,减少数据库的I/O成本,就像书的目录一样,它可以帮助我们快速定位到书中的内容。 索引结构 MySQL的索引是在存储引擎层实现的,不同的存储引擎有不同的结构,主要包括以下几种: 索引结构 描述 B+Tree索引 最常见的索引类型,大部分引擎都支持B+Tree索引 Hash索引 底层是哈希表